What MLIL-001 Covers — Key Themes for the Exam
Understanding the core recurring themes in the Term End Examination (TEE) is essential for prioritizing your study schedule effectively. By analyzing past papers, students can identify which technical concepts the examiners emphasize most, allowing for a more targeted approach to complex computing topics. This strategy transforms a broad syllabus into a manageable set of high-yield learning objectives that directly correlate with exam performance.
- Computer Architecture and Organization — Examiners frequently test the functional components of a computer system, including the CPU, ALU, and control units. Understanding the Von Neumann architecture and the bus system is vital because it explains how data flows through the hardware to produce meaningful output.
- Memory Hierarchy and Storage Media — This theme covers the differences between primary memory like RAM and ROM versus secondary storage devices like HDD and SSD. Questions often require students to compare access speeds, volatility, and storage capacities, which are critical for managing digital library databases.
- Operating Systems and Software Classification — System software versus application software is a recurring topic that tests your ability to categorize programs. Examiners look for a deep understanding of OS functions like memory management and file handling, which are the backbone of any automated information system.
- Data Representation and Binary Logic — The conversion between decimal, binary, and hexadecimal systems is a staple of the MLIL-001 paper. Mastery of ASCII and Unicode standards is also expected, as these form the basis for how text-based information is encoded and stored in global library networks.
- Networking Fundamentals and Topologies — Questions often focus on the physical and logical arrangement of networks, such as Star, Ring, and Mesh topologies. Knowing the OSI model and TCP/IP protocols is essential for students to explain how computers communicate within a local or wide area network.
- Input/Output Devices and Interfacing — This theme examines the hardware used to interact with computer systems, ranging from traditional keyboards to advanced scanners and sensors. Examiners test the technical specifications and use cases of these devices to ensure students can design ergonomic and efficient digital workstations.

How Past Papers Help You Score Better in TEE
Exam Pattern
The TEE usually carries 50 marks for the theory component, consisting of essay-type questions and brief technical explanations. Balance your answers between diagrams and text.
Important Topics
Focus heavily on Operating System functions, Database Management concepts, and Networking Topologies as these appear in almost every session’s question paper.
Answer Writing
Use technical terminology accurately. For computer science papers, structured points and block diagrams are more effective than long, dense paragraphs for scoring marks.
Time Management
Allocate 45 minutes for heavy essay questions and 15 minutes for short notes. Save the final 10 minutes to review your technical diagrams and labels for accuracy.
